After years of working with people from all walks of life, I began to see a pattern: the very struggles bringing people to therapy—anxiety, depression, relationship challenges, self-doubt—were often the ways they had learned to cope and survive.
​
If you’ve experienced trauma, overwhelm, or feeling unsafe, you may have adapted in ways that once protected you but now feel limiting. Together, we’ll explore these patterns with compassion, helping you find new ways of being that feel more free, authentic, and aligned with who you truly are.

Coherence Therapy
-
Uncovers hidden emotional truths driving your struggles
-
Helps you fully experience and transform core beliefs
-
Uses the brain’s natural process to create lasting change
Memory Reconsolidation
-
The brain naturally rewrites emotional memories
-
This leads to deep, lasting change
-
No need for ongoing effort to maintain the change
Person-Centered Approach
-
You lead the conversation at your own pace
-
Creates a safe, non-judgmental space for growth
-
Trust and empathy help you understand yourself better
